概要

IoTミドルウェア市場は、2023年に155億2,000万米ドルと評価され、2024年には178億米ドルに達すると予測され、CAGR 16.87%で成長し、2030年には462億7,000万米ドルに達すると予測されています。

IoTミドルウェアは、異種のIoTデバイスやアプリケーション間の通信、相互運用性、制御を容易にする重要なソフトウェア層として機能し、広範なIoTエコシステムにおいて不可欠な役割を果たします。その必要性は、IoT環境における多様なデバイス、プロトコル、データフォーマットに起因しており、シームレスな統合と管理を保証するための結束したメカニズムを必要とします。IoTミドルウェアは、スマートホーム、ヘルスケア、製造業、運輸業などの業界で幅広く適用されており、これらの分野でデータ主導型の洞察を活用し、業務効率を向上させ、ユーザー体験を高めることを可能にしています。エンドユースの範囲は広大で、異種システムの接続の複雑さを伴わずにIoTソリューションを実装しようとする企業を包含しています。コネクテッドデバイスの需要が急増し続ける中、AI、リアルタイムデータ分析、エッジコンピューティングの進歩が主要な成長要因となっており、ミドルウェアの機能を強化し、イノベーションを促進しています。クラウドベースのソリューションと相互運用性標準の重視の高まりが、市場をさらに後押ししています。しかし、この分野は、セキュリティの問題、高い導入コスト、標準化されたプロトコルの欠如などの課題に直面しており、これが成長の妨げになる可能性があります。こうした課題を克服するため、企業は、進化する業界のニーズに対応できる、安全でコスト効率が高く、柔軟なミドルウェア・ソリューションの開発に注力すべきです。5Gやブロックチェーンなどの新技術とミドルウェアを統合することで、接続性とデータセキュリティが強化される可能性があります。従って、技術革新の機が熟している分野には、セキュリティに特化したミドルウェア、AI主導のミドルウェアプラットフォーム、低遅延通信を促進するソリューションなどがあります。また、企業は、特定の企業ニーズに対応するために、カスタマイズ可能で拡張性の高いミドルウェア・ソリューションの提供を拡大することも検討すべきです。市場力学はダイナミックであり、技術革新や顧客のさまざまな要求に大きく影響されるため、企業は競争優位性を確保するために機敏な対応力を維持することが不可欠です。

主な市場の統計
基準年[2023] 155億2,000万米ドル
推定年[2024] 178億米ドル
予測年[2030] 462億7,000万米ドル
CAGR(%) 16.87%

市場力学:急速に進化するIoTミドルウェア市場の主要市場インサイトを公開

IoTミドルウェア市場は、需要と供給のダイナミックな相互作用によって変貌を遂げています。このような市場力学の進化を理解することで、企業は十分な情報に基づいた投資決定、戦略的決定の精緻化、そして新たなビジネスチャンスの獲得に備えることができます。これらの動向を包括的に把握することで、企業は政治的、地理的、技術的、社会的、経済的な領域にわたる様々なリスクを軽減することができるとともに、消費者行動とそれが製造コストや購買動向に与える影響をより明確に理解することができます。

  • 市場促進要因
    • リアルタイムデータ分析に対する需要の高まり
    • 相互運用性と標準化への注目の高まり
    • 拡張可能なストレージと最適な処理能力を備えたクラウドプラットフォームの採用拡大
  • 市場抑制要因
    • IoT技術やミドルウェア開発の熟練した専門家の不足
  • 市場機会
    • 5G、LPWAN、NB-IoT技術などの接続技術の進歩
    • データ管理のためのIoTデバイスの採用増加
  • 市場の課題
    • IoTミドルウェアソリューションに対するデータプライバシーとセキュリティの懸念

The IoT Middleware Market was valued at USD 15.52 billion in 2023, expected to reach USD 17.80 billion in 2024, and is projected to grow at a CAGR of 16.87%, to USD 46.27 billion by 2030.

IoT Middleware serves as a crucial software layer that facilitates communication, interoperability, and control among disparate IoT devices and applications, thereby playing an essential role in the broader IoT ecosystem. Its necessity stems from the diverse range of devices, protocols, and data formats in IoT environments, which require a cohesive mechanism to ensure seamless integration and management. IoT Middleware is applied extensively across industries including smart homes, healthcare, manufacturing, and transportation, enabling these sectors to leverage data-driven insights, improve operational efficiencies, and enhance user experiences. The end-use scope is vast, encompassing businesses seeking to implement IoT solutions without the complexity of connecting heterogeneous systems. As the demand for connected devices continues to surge, key growth factors include advancements in AI, real-time data analytics, and edge computing, which are enhancing middleware capabilities and fostering innovation. The growing emphasis on cloud-based solutions and interoperability standards further propels the market. However, this sector faces challenges such as security issues, high implementation costs, and the lack of standardized protocols, which may hinder growth. To navigate these challenges, businesses should focus on developing secure, cost-effective, and flexible middleware solutions that can cater to evolving industry needs. Opportunities lie in the integration of middleware with emerging technologies such as 5G and blockchain, which could offer enhanced connectivity and data security. Thus, areas ripe for innovation include security-focused middleware, AI-driven middleware platforms, and solutions that facilitate low-latency communications. Companies should also consider expanding their offerings to include customizable, scalable middleware solutions to meet specific enterprise needs. The IoT Middleware market is dynamic, heavily influenced by technological breakthroughs and varied customer demands, making it vital for businesses to remain agile and responsive to ensure competitive advantage.

KEY MARKET STATISTICS
Base Year [2023] USD 15.52 billion
Estimated Year [2024] USD 17.80 billion
Forecast Year [2030] USD 46.27 billion
CAGR (%) 16.87%

Market Dynamics: Unveiling Key Market Insights in the Rapidly Evolving IoT Middleware Market

The IoT Middleware Market is undergoing transformative changes driven by a dynamic interplay of supply and demand factors. Understanding these evolving market dynamics prepares business organizations to make informed investment decisions, refine strategic decisions, and seize new opportunities. By gaining a comprehensive view of these trends, business organizations can mitigate various risks across political, geographic, technical, social, and economic domains while also gaining a clearer understanding of consumer behavior and its impact on manufacturing costs and purchasing trends.

  • Market Drivers
    • Rising demand for real-time data analytics
    • Increasing focus on interoperability and standardization
    • Growing adoption of cloud platforms for scalable storage and optimum processing power
  • Market Restraints
    • Limited skilled professionals in IoT technologies and middleware development
  • Market Opportunities
    • Advancements in connectivity technologies such as 5G, LPWAN, and NB-IoT technologies
    • Increased adoption of IoT devices for data management
  • Market Challenges
    • Data privacy and security concerns for IoT middleware solutions
